Ticket: GLH-2241. The Hallveil audio-guide app drops mid-track when a visitor walks between gallery beacons faster than the crossfade completes. Steps to reproduce: open the Brentmoor Museum tour, start exhibit track 7, then simulate beacon handoff within 2 seconds using the debug panel. Audio cuts to silence rather than fading. Observed on build 4.2.1, both platforms. To replay against the staging narration API, authenticate with the token provided below.

session JWT of yawep-yawep = eyJhbGciOiJIUzI1NiIsInR5cCI6IkpXVCJ9.eyJzdWIiOiI3pWF3_In0.aXYsHiog

TICKET-977: Marlowe CSV import wizard accepts formula-prefixed cells without sanitization, enabling spreadsheet injection on export. Scope: all tenant upload paths in the Harborline suite. Mitigation deployed: prefix escaping plus MIME validation. Requesting security review of the escaping logic before GA. The patched build carries the trace token below.

session token of tajef-bageg = htk21_5d90d574934f3ccae6437

**Leadership Review Briefing – Calder & Voss Term Sheet**

Quick one for sales leads: Calder & Voss sent over their term sheet for the distribution partnership. Headline terms are friendlier than expected — lower minimum volumes, co-marketing funds included. Exclusivity ask is the sticking point; we're pushing back to a two-region carve-out. Legal review wraps next week. Keep pipeline conversations neutral until we sign. There's one confidential note attached below for context.

management briefing: Project Ulavan slips by two quarters because of the staffing delay.